Augšlīgatne

Augšlīgatne is a village in , and has about 1,430 residents. Augšlīgatne is situated nearby to the locality , as well as near the hamlet .

Līgatne is a town in Līgatne Parish, in the region of . It is situated on the . The village of Līgatne was built around the paper mill, still extant, on the River Līgatne in the 19th century.
